Celestial Delights Illuminate November Skies: Venus, Jupiter, And Meteor Shower Captivate Stargazers

In a mesmerizing celestial display, stargazers and astronomy enthusiasts are in for a treat this November as the night sky hosts a series of captivating events. Early risers and night owls alike are being treated to a celestial dance between Venus and Jupiter, both of which grace opposite sides of the sky, creating a stunning visual spectacle. On November 9, observers were delighted to witness a slender crescent moon hanging just beneath Venus before sunrise, marking a rare celestial alignment.

Meanwhile, Saturn, the ringed planet, takes centre stage in the night sky, residing within the constellation Aquarius, aptly known as "the Sea." This region of the sky is adorned with water-related constellations, including Pisces, Capricornus, and Aquarius itself, adding a touch of mystique to the cosmic panorama. Sky gazers are encouraged to explore this watery realm, finding solace in the ancient myths and legends that have shaped these constellations.

Adding to the celestial festivities is the highly anticipated Leonid meteor shower, set to peak overnight on November 17th. Originating from comet Tempel-Tuttle, these meteors are renowned for their brightness and long-lasting trains that linger in the night sky. To best experience this natural spectacle, astronomers advise finding a dark, secluded spot away from city lights, lying down, and looking straight up. With the Moon in its first-quarter phase on the peak night, minimal interference is expected, promising a breathtaking meteor shower display.

In a remarkable cosmic endeavour, NASA is inviting people around the world to participate in a unique initiative. As part of the upcoming Europa Clipper mission set to explore Jupiter's icy moon Europa, individuals have been allowed to send their names etched on the spacecraft. This symbolic gesture serves as a bridge between Earth and the distant ocean world of Europa, emphasizing humanity's boundless curiosity and desire to explore the mysteries of the universe.
